Output 23f3f43f4aaa06ddceeeea423d51545e67e563516e514b4f778001a4799e29e1:47

value
1759954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66484572038222f6a3ea1906c05e38671e27375a OP_EQUAL
address
3B1qRc8AjtEqzqHxiE4ANu6rXyaQN9jwTo
transaction
23f3f43f4aaa06ddceeeea423d51545e67e563516e514b4f778001a4799e29e1
confirmations
232619
spent
true